The Root of the Roar: Understanding Why We Snore

Before diving into solutions, it’s crucial to understand the enemy. Snoring isn’t just noise; it’s a physiological event. When we sleep, the muscles in our throat and tongue relax. For some, this relaxation, combined with gravity, causes the tissues in the upper airway to narrow. As air passes through this restricted space, it causes the soft palate, uvula, tongue, and tonsils to vibrate. These vibrations produce the characteristic sound we know as snoring.

While occasional, light snoring can be harmless, chronic and loud snoring can indicate a more serious condition: Obstructive Sleep Apnea (OSA). With OSA, the airway repeatedly collapses completely or partially during sleep, leading to pauses in breathing. These pauses, or apneas, trigger the brain to briefly wake up, disrupting the sleep cycle. Differentiating between primary snoring and OSA is critical, as OSA carries significant health risks, including high blood pressure, heart disease, stroke, and diabetes. This is why professional diagnosis is non-negotiable before attempting self-treatment.

The Method – A Deep Dive into Mandibular Advancement Devices

A mandibular advancement device is precisely what it sounds like: a custom-fitted or moldable device worn in the mouth, similar to a sports mouthguard, that gently holds the lower jaw (mandible) slightly forward during sleep. This seemingly simple action has a profound impact on the airway.

The Core Mechanism: How a MAD Works

By gently protruding the lower jaw (mandible), a MAD achieves several critical effects:

  • Tensioning the Airway Tissues: Moving the jaw forward pulls the base of the tongue and the soft tissues of the throat forward. This action tenses these muscles and tissues, preventing them from relaxing backward and collapsing into the airway.
  • Widening the Airway: With the tissues held forward, the pharyngeal space (the area behind the tongue and soft palate) widens significantly.
  • Reducing Vibration: A wider, more stable airway allows air to pass through smoothly and silently, thus eliminating or drastically reducing the vibrations that cause snoring.

This direct, mechanical approach makes the MAD an incredibly effective snoring solution for many individuals who suffer from primary snoring or mild to moderate OSA.

Choosing Your Type: Boil-and-Bite vs. Custom-Fit

The world of anti-snoring mouthpieces generally splits into two main categories, each with its own advantages and considerations:

1. Boil-and-Bite (Thermoplastic) Devices:

These are the most accessible and affordable type of MAD. They are typically made from a thermoplastic material that softens when heated and then molds to the shape of your teeth when you bite down.

  • Accessibility: Widely available online and in pharmacies.
  • Cost-Effective: Significantly less expensive than custom-fit options.
  • At-Home Fitting: Can be molded to your mouth in minutes.
  • Potential Drawbacks: Fit may not be as precise, leading to less comfort or effectiveness. Durability can be an issue, and they often lack advanced adjustability.

2. Professionally Fitted (Custom-Made) Devices:

These devices are prescribed and fitted by a dentist or sleep specialist. They involve taking impressions of your teeth and often using advanced CAD/CAM technology to create a device that is perfectly contoured to your unique oral anatomy.

  • Superior Comfort: Designed to fit precisely, minimizing discomfort and maximizing wearability.
  • Optimal Efficacy: The precise fit and often greater range of adjustable advancement lead to higher success rates.
  • Durability: Made from higher-quality, more robust materials designed for long-term use.
  • Safety & Guidance: Provided under professional supervision, ensuring it’s appropriate for your condition and adjusted correctly.
  • Higher Cost: Requires professional consultation and laboratory fabrication, making it more expensive.

Key Features for Comfort and Efficacy

When choosing an anti-snoring mouthpiece, look for features that enhance both comfort and effectiveness:

  • Adjustable Advancement: Many MADs, particularly custom-fitted ones, allow for incremental adjustments to how far forward the lower jaw is positioned. This is crucial for gradual acclimation and finding the optimal advancement level that stops snoring without causing undue discomfort.
  • Hypoallergenic Materials: Look for medical-grade, BPA-free, and latex-free materials to prevent allergic reactions or irritation.
  • Airflow Channels/Breathing Holes: For individuals who tend to breathe through their mouth while sleeping, devices with small channels allow for oral breathing, preventing a feeling of suffocation and improving comfort.
  • Slim Design: A less bulky device is generally more comfortable and easier to get used to.

Comfort & Side Effects

It’s common to experience some temporary side effects when first using a mandibular advancement device. These might include:

  • Jaw Soreness: Your jaw muscles are getting used to a new position. This usually subsides within a few days or weeks. Starting with minimal advancement and gradually increasing it can help.
  • Tooth Discomfort/Sensitivity: Mild pressure on teeth is normal. If severe, consult your dentist.
  • Excess Salivation: The mouth may produce more saliva initially as it senses a foreign object. This typically lessens over time.
  • Dry Mouth: Some users experience dryness, especially if they are mouth breathers. Devices with airflow channels can help.

Most side effects are temporary and mild. If they persist or are severe, discontinue use and consult your healthcare provider. The ability to utilize adjustable settings is key to mitigating discomfort and finding the sweet spot for effectiveness and wearability.

Safety & Suitability

Not everyone is a suitable candidate for an anti-snoring mouthpiece. It’s crucial to consult a professional to determine if a MAD is right for you, especially if you have:

  • TMJ (Temporomandibular Joint) Disorders: Moving the jaw forward can exacerbate TMJ issues.
  • Certain Dental Conditions: Extensive bridgework, loose teeth, severe gum disease, or insufficient natural teeth can make a MAD unsuitable.
  • Central Sleep Apnea: MADs are effective for obstructive sleep apnea, not central sleep apnea (where the brain fails to send signals to breathe).
  • Insufficient Teeth: For the device to be stable, you need a sufficient number of healthy teeth. Denture wearers might require specific custom solutions.

Again, the medical disclaimer cannot be overstated here. A professional assessment protects your oral health and ensures the device is appropriate for your specific snoring or sleep apnea type.

Care and Maintenance

Proper care extends the life of your snoring solution and ensures hygiene:

  • Clean Daily: Use a soft toothbrush and mild soap or non-abrasive denture cleaner. Avoid harsh chemicals or toothpaste, which can damage the material.
  • Rinse Thoroughly: Ensure no cleaning residues remain.
  • Store Properly: Keep the device in its protective case when not in use to prevent damage and bacteria buildup.
  • Regular Inspections: Check for cracks, wear, or damage, especially with boil-and-bite versions, which may need replacing more frequently.

FAQs

1. What is the difference between a Mandibular Advancement Device (MAD) and a Tongue Stabilizing Device (TSD)?

A Mandibular Advancement Device (MAD) works by gently moving the lower jaw forward to open the airway. A Tongue Stabilizing Device (TSD) works by holding the tongue forward using suction, preventing it from falling back and obstructing the airway. Both are anti-snoring devices, but they use different mechanisms and may be suited for different individuals based on the specific cause of their snoring and oral anatomy.

2. How long does it take to get used to wearing an anti-snoring mouthpiece?

Most people require a “break-in” period, typically ranging from a few days to a couple of weeks. Initial discomfort, such as jaw soreness, tooth sensitivity, or increased salivation, is common. Gradually increasing the wear time and adjustment settings (if available) can help with acclimation. If discomfort persists beyond a few weeks, consult your dentist or doctor.

3. Are there any long-term risks to moving my jaw forward every night?

When used under professional guidance, MADs are generally safe. However, potential long-term risks, especially with improper use or ill-fitting devices, can include changes in bite alignment, tooth movement, or exacerbation of TMJ issues. This is why professional fitting and regular check-ups with a dentist are highly recommended, particularly for custom-made devices.
